Paper and spreadsheets work right up until the plant no longer fits in one person's head. The problem starts the week that person goes on holiday.
Repairs, replacements and inspections sit on the machine's record rather than in a supervisor's memory. A new technician gets up to speed in an afternoon instead of six months.
The operator scans a QR code on the machine, photographs the fault and sends it. If reporting is slower than shouting across the hall, nobody uses it and the data goes stale within a month.
The system tracks intervals and due dates. Without that, preventive maintenance always loses to something more urgent — which is not negligence, it is the natural order of things.
Every part is tied to machines and has a monitored minimum, so you order before production is waiting on a courier.
Availability, repair times and the cost of downtime. These are the arguments for investment that no spreadsheet produces on its own.
Most systems handle records and scheduling. The differences that decide it in daily use are the ones nobody asks about during the demo.
If every operator needs an account and training, only the maintenance team will ever report anything. Involving the whole shop floor requires reporting that needs nothing but a phone and a label on the machine.
Not "has a mobile version" but usable in gloves, in poor light and on a weak signal. A technician will not walk to the office to write something down.
PDF documentation on the machine's record. Searching binders is the most common silent waste of time, and nobody measures it.
Per-user pricing makes companies ration access, and rationed access breaks the data. Paying for the scope of the system produces better results.
Every plant has something of its own. Either the system can add it, or the plant bends around the software — and the second option costs more than it looks.
